To rebuild the distributor on a 1987 Chevy 305, start by removing the distributor from the engine. Once removed, take off the cap and rotor, and inspect or replace the ignition module and pickup coil if necessary. Clean all components, replace worn parts, and reassemble the distributor. Finally, reinstall the distributor, ensuring it is properly timed with the engine.

Since this category is 305-350, I'll have to assume that YOUR engine is one of the two mentioned. The 1990 Chev 305 and 350 did not use a timing belt. They used a timing chain, and unless something really odd happened, you should never need to replace the timing chain until you rebuild the engine.
